MacTeX installs like i-Installer in /usr/local/teTeX (mostly, some  
utilities go into /usr/local/bin or /usr/local/lib etc.). The TeX  
binaries have a routine built in that makes them search "in the  
vicinity" of their installation place for configuration files to  
learn where STY, CLS, font files etc. are. By switching the search  
paths for these binaries you could use either TeX Live or (via i- 
Installer) up-to-date MacTeX ...
